Fig. 7: Normalized relative toxicity (NRT).
From: A unimolecule nanopesticide delivery system applied in field scale for enhanced pest control

a The index of the relative toxicity (IRT), which was defined as the highest value of LC50 over the LC50 of the experimental samples. b LC50 (left) and normalized relative toxicity (NRT, right) values were calculated from D. rerio. and IRT. NRT is defined as the product between the index of relative toxicity (IRT) of pests and the LC50 of non-target organism. c LC50 (left) and NRT values (right) were calculated from E. foetida and IRT. d LC50 (left) and NRT values (right) were calculated from Apis mellifera L. and IRT. “LC50 (left)” and “NRT (right)” refer to the values situated to the left and to the right of the solid black line in each panel.
